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of cement curing technology, specifically to a cement curing heating device for water conservancy construction. Background Technology

[0002] Cement reacts chemically with water to produce various hydration products such as calcium silicate hydrate and calcium hydroxide. This process is crucial for cement to harden and gain strength. When the ambient temperature is low, the hydration reaction of cement becomes very slow. This is because low temperature reduces the chemical reaction rate on the surface of cement particles, which slows down the formation of hydration products and thus slows down the development of concrete strength. For example, during construction in cold winter, if heating measures are not taken, concrete may take a long time to reach the demolding strength or design strength, and may even be unusable due to insufficient strength over a long period of time.

[0003] In existing technologies, newly constructed concrete walls contain a large amount of moisture in cold weather, and the low ambient temperature makes it difficult for the concrete to solidify. Furthermore, the moisture inside the concrete will freeze and expand, thereby compromising the overall strength of the concrete. Currently, in cold weather, stoves are usually lit indoors immediately after construction to maintain a certain temperature and accelerate the solidification of the concrete walls. However, this method requires the stove to burn continuously to maintain the indoor temperature, which is quite wasteful of energy. Utility Model Content

[0004] Based on this, the purpose of this utility model is to provide a cement curing heating device for water conservancy construction, so as to solve the technical problem that it is wasteful of energy to use a stove to maintain the indoor temperature after construction is completed in a low-temperature environment.

[0022] The embodiments of this utility model will be described below based on its overall structure.

[0023] A cement curing heating device for hydraulic construction, such as Figure 1-5 As shown, it includes two sets of fixed seats 1, two sets of electric telescopic rods 2 are fixedly connected between the two sets of fixed seats 1, fixed plates 3 are fixedly connected to both ends of the two sets of fixed seats 1, and rotating shafts 4 are movably connected between each pair of fixed plates 3. A heat-relieving blanket 5 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of one set of rotating shafts 4, and a set of rotating shafts 4 is movably connected to the inner side of the heat-relieving blanket 5. One end of the heat-relieving blanket 5 is connected to the inside of the fixed seat 1.

[0024] When the electric telescopic rod 2 is activated, the two sets of electric telescopic rods 2 will move the top fixed seat 1 upward. The top fixed seat 1 is connected to a rotating shaft 4 on one side, and the heat-relieving blanket 5 is fixed to the outer wall of the rotating shaft 4. Since the two ends of the rotating shaft 4 are connected to the fixed plate 3 through the connecting shaft 6, and the fixed plate 3 is connected to the two ends of the fixed seat 1 through bolts 9, the heat-relieving blanket 5 will move upward with the fixed seat 1.

[0025] Furthermore, after moving a certain distance, the switch of the heat-dissipating blanket 5 can be activated, causing the heat-dissipating blanket 5 to start working and dissipate heat, thereby providing close-range insulation to the concrete wall and accelerating the solidification rate of the concrete wall.

[0026] Please see Figure 4 and Figure 6 Each set of fixed plates 3 is rotatably connected to a connecting shaft 6 on its inner side. The ends of every two sets of connecting shafts 6 are rotatably connected to a rotating shaft 4. One set of rotating shafts 4 has torsion springs 7 inside both ends. One set of rotating shafts 4 is elastically connected to the connecting shaft 6 through the torsion springs 7.

[0027] The upper rotating shaft 4 is equipped with torsion springs 7 at both ends. When the fixed seat 1 drives the heat-relieving blanket 5 to rise, the rotating shaft 4 will store force on the torsion springs 7. When the heat-relieving blanket 5 descends, the rotating shaft 4 will slowly rotate under the elastic action of the torsion springs 7, thereby rolling up the heat-relieving blanket 5.

[0028] Please see Figure 2 and Figure 5 One of the fixed bases 1 has a charging port 8 on one side. The charging port 8 is used to connect the power supply. The user can insert an external charger into the charging port 8 on one side of the fixed base 1 and connect the charger to the power supply, so that the whole heat dissipation device can be powered on.

[0029] Please see Figure 4 and Figure 6The fixing seat 1 has cavities at both ends, and the cavities at both ends of the fixing seat 1 are matched with the size of the fixing plate 3. The fixing plate 3 has threaded holes at the top, and the fixing seat 1 has bolts 9 at the top. The fixing seat 1 is fixedly connected to the fixing plate 3 by bolts 9. The fixing plate 3 is connected to both ends of the fixing seat 1 by bolts 9, so the heat-relieving blanket 5 can move upward with the fixing seat 1.
